Description
D-Link DIR-882 DIR882A1_FW130B06 was discovered to contain a stack overflow via the sub_477AA0 function.
Comprehensive Technical Analysis of CVE-2024-22751
1. Vulnerability Assessment and Severity Evaluation
CVE ID: CVE-2024-22751 CVSS Score: 9.8
The vulnerability in question is a stack overflow in the D-Link DIR-882 router, specifically in the sub_477AA0 function of the firmware version DIR882A1_FW130B06. A CVSS score of 9.8 indicates a critical severity level, suggesting that this vulnerability poses a significant risk to affected systems. The high score is likely due to the potential for remote code execution, which can lead to complete system compromise.
2. Potential Attack Vectors and Exploitation Methods
Attack Vectors:
- Remote Exploitation: An attacker could exploit this vulnerability remotely by sending specially crafted packets to the router.
- Local Network Exploitation: An attacker with access to the local network could exploit the vulnerability to gain control over the router.
Exploitation Methods:
- Buffer Overflow: The attacker can send a large amount of data to the sub_477AA0 function, causing a stack overflow. This can lead to arbitrary code execution.
- Payload Delivery: Once the stack overflow is triggered, the attacker can inject malicious code to gain control over the router.

4. Recommended Mitigation Strategies
Immediate Actions:
- Firmware Update: Users should immediately update their D-Link DIR-882 routers to the latest firmware version provided by D-Link.
- Network Segmentation: Isolate the router from critical network segments to limit potential damage.
- Firewall Rules: Implement strict firewall rules to block unsolicited incoming traffic to the router.
Long-Term Strategies:
- Regular Patch Management: Establish a routine for regularly checking and applying firmware updates.
- Intrusion Detection Systems (IDS): Deploy IDS to monitor for suspicious activities that may indicate an exploitation attempt.
- Security Audits: Conduct regular security audits to identify and mitigate potential vulnerabilities.
